Export Warehousing Facility
Extends to Tijara Tehsil of Alwar
(Raj)
[CBEC
Circular No. 949 dated 19th July 2011]
Subject: Export
warehousing –Extension of facility at Tijara Tehsil of Alwar
District in the state of Rajasthan.
I am directed to refer to Board’s Circular No.
581/18/2001-CX dated 29th June, 2001 which, inter-alia, specifies
conditions, procedures, class of exporters and places under sub-rule (2) of
rule 20 of Central Excise Rules, 2002 for warehousing of excisable goods for
the purpose of export. In paragraph 2(2) of the said Circular, the Board has
specified places where warehouses may be established to store excisable goods
for export. The Board has received representations from the trade to include Tijara Tehsil of Alwar
District in the state of Rajasthan in the list of places
mentioned in the said Circular.
2. The matter has been examined. Board is of the view that
extension of the facility of export warehousing to Tijara Tehsil of Alwar
District in the state of Rajasthan would facilitate the trade and
industry. Therefore, it has been decided to amend paragraph 2(2) of the
Circular No. 581/18/2001-CX dated 29th June, 2001 to include Tijara Tehsil of Alwar
District in the state of Rajasthan. Accordingly, the said
paragraph shall now read as follows:
“(2) Places: The
warehouses may be established and registered in Ahmedabad, Bangalore, Kolkata,
Chennai, Delhi, Hyderabad, Jaipur, Kanpur, Ludhiana, Mumbai, the districts of
Pune and Raigad in the state of Maharashtra, the
district of East Midnapore in the state of West
Bengal, the district of Kancheepuram in the state of Tamilnadu, the district of Indore in the state of Madhya
Pradesh, the taluka Ankleshwar
in the district of Bharuch in the state of Gujarat, Navi
Mumbai in the district of Thane in the state of Maharashtra, Sholinghur in the district of Vellore in the state of Tamilnadu, Bidadi in the
Bangalore Rural District, Karnataka, the district of Thiruvallur
in the state of Tamilnadu, the
district of Gautam Budh
Nagar in the state of Uttar Pradesh, the district of Nagpur in the state of
Maharashtra and the Tehsil of Tijara of Alwar district in the state of Rajasthan.”
3. The field formations may suitably
be informed.
